2Co 3:2 You are our letter, written in our hearts, known and read by all men;

2Co 3:3 being manifested that you are a letter of Christ, cared for by us, written not with ink, but with the Spirit of the living God, not on tablets of stone, but on tablets of human hearts.

2Co 3:4 And such confidence we have through Christ toward God. 5 Not that we are adequate in ourselves to consider anything as coming from ourselves, but our adequacy is from God, 6 who also made us adequate as servants of a new covenant, not of the letter, but of the Spirit; for the letter kills, but the Spirit gives life.

2Co 3:7 But if the ministry of death, in letters engraved on stones, came with glory, so that the sons of Israel could not look intently at the face of Moses because of the glory of his face, fading as it was, 8 how shall the ministry of the Spirit fail to be even more with glory? 9 For if the ministry of condemnation has glory, much more does the ministry of righteousness abound in glory. 10 For indeed what had glory, in this case has no glory on account of the glory that surpasses it.

The “LETTER” is identified as that which is engraved on stone. Inflexible, cut and dried doctrine. Incapable of change. Unbendable in concept and tradition.

It may seem like a stretch to compare the fading of the glory on Moses’ face as a prophetic application to the fading away of the Old Covenant ministry of the “letter.” Laying aside of the “letter”, however, IS the introduction to the ministry of the Spirit! This reveals a new dimension of the New Covenant Ministry of the Spirit. Obviously, Paul considered this New Covenant ministry to be in effect when he wrote this letter. He considered the ministry of the letter ( mechanics, facts, intellect, doctrines and tradition) to be of the past, connected with the Old Covenant.

The New Covenant was also demonstrated by the ministry of the Holy Spirit to the lame man at the temple gate.

Act 3:6 But Peter said, “I do not possess silver and gold, but what I do have I give to you: In the name of Jesus Christ the Nazarene –walk!” 7 And seizing him by the right hand, he raised him up; and immediately his feet and his ankles were strengthened. 8 And with a leap, he stood upright and began to walk; and he entered the temple with them, walking and leaping and praising God.

Neither Peter or John quoted the scripture that by His stripes you were healed. They didn’t hand the man a tract about healing. They just manifested the ministry of the Spirit according to the New Covenant. They ministered “healing” as a tangible benefit to the man. If they had a pocket full of money they may have been tempted to give the man an offering and send him away. Then their being broke became a wonderful blessing for the lame man. “Rise and walk” becomes the reality of the New Covenant ministry. This IS TRUTH and not just an encouraging word to a sick person. This is not “Well, Lord, thy will be done.” The healing of the lame man demonstrated Spirit and Life. The “letter” could never help this man. “Letter” means hand him a tract and pray for him when we get home.
